Businesses are changing due to emerging technologies like AI and generative AI. Despite their close kinship, they differ in a few crucial ways. 

One particular kind of AI is called "generative AI," and it produces text, images, videos, and music. It replicates various types of content by using artificial intelligence (AI) algorithms to examine trends in datasets. It can also produce voice messages and deep fake videos.

Artificial Intelligence (AI), conversely, is a technology that can carry out operations that often call for human intelligence. AI is used to create systems that can mine data, learn from past experiences, and progressively get better at what they do.

Comprehending Artificial Intelligence 

A subset of AI explicitly designed for content generation is called generative AI. It uses neural networks, algorithms, and big language models to create content by looking for patterns in the already existing data. It establishes what can be considered "original" content, but in reality, it mimics human creativity by using machine-learning algorithms. Large datasets that frequently include a diverse range of online content serve as inspiration for generative AI. 

Automated Learning Systems 

Advanced machine learning techniques are the foundation of generative AI. Based on user inputs, these algorithms continuously rework and modify already-existing content to produce "new" content.

Making Use of Already-Existing Creativity 

The abundance of human-generated information, including books, essays, research papers, creative visuals, and even music, inspires generative AI. Notably, it has been utilized to write whole new songs, which has created a stir within the music business. 

Making Use of Huge Datasets 

The ability of generative AI to evaluate large databases—like those of insurance or logistics companies—is one of its most impressive features. It can produce unique business processes or data, giving it a competitive advantage. 

Using Generative AI Cases 

In creative domains like music, painting, and product creation, generative AI is essential. It creates new content, which helps musicians, writers, graphic designers, and artists. It is used in concept research, design variants, and product descriptions in the business world. 

Generating content: From business letters to preliminary drafts of essays, generative AI can produce readable content on various subjects. Even employing generative AI to create news items has been tested by a few news outlets. 

Image Generating: In response to verbal prompts, it can generate realistic or strange images, mimicking freshly painted scenes. Nonetheless, copyright issues have been brought up by the photographs' provenance, which frequently comes from preexisting sources. 

Generating Video: Short films can be quickly produced using generative AI, which automatically assembles text into video material. 

Generating Music: It can create original music in a particular style by analyzing a music library. Exciting outcomes have been obtained through collaboration between generative AI and human artists. 

Product Design: Generative AI is a handy tool for product designers as it can propose different designs and speed up the creative process. 

Customization: It improves user experiences quickly by providing personalized content, product recommendations, and distinctive customization.

Knowing Artificial Intelligence 

Conversely, artificial intelligence (AI) is a more expansive notion intended to replicate or exceed human intelligence via systems and software. AI-powered computers are designed to do intricate operations, evaluate vast volumes of data, and reach choices quickly. 

Recognition of Patterns 

AI is quite good at finding patterns in large datasets. It uses specialized GPU processors for quick computation, and some systems even use predictive analytics to forecast how these patterns might affect the future. 

Improving Judgment Making 

Businesses can improve their decision-making processes with the help of AI. It finds growth opportunities, spots possible risks, and provides answers like better product suggestions and customer support. It can also be an extra advisor for CEOs, offering AI and humans suggestions. 

Enhanced Analytics 

AI improves data analytics by providing faster and more accurate results. It enhances corporate operations and produces better results and competitive advantages by quickly identifying trends. 

AI Applications 

Applications of AI are found in many different fields; some of the more important ones are as follows: 

Automation: Artificial Intelligence (AI) streamlines intricate procedures, improving network configuration, device provisioning, and monitoring efficiency. Another aspect of automating repetitive operations is robotic process automation. 

Speed: Artificial intelligence (AI) analyzes data remarkably quickly, utilizing machine learning and neural networks to identify patterns and opportunities almost instantly. 

Chat: AI-powered chat and chatbots are becoming commonplace tools that enhance search and customer support features, among other things. With time, these systems get better and better at facilitating more organic dialogues. 

Enhanced Security: By automating threat detection and mitigation, artificial intelligence (AI) supports cybersecurity efforts by using machine learning algorithms to detect irregularities in network architecture.

AI vs. Generative AI: The Difference 

In summary, while generative AI and AI rely on algorithms, their functions are distinct. As a creative force that creates new content by merging pre existing patterns, generative AI is a disruptive artificial intelligence. Conversely, artificial intelligence (AI) covers many uses and is primarily concerned with data processing, decision-making, and automation. 

While traditional AI is deeply ingrained in organizations, improving procedures and data analytics, generative AI finds its home in creative industries and personalization. 

AI and generative AI applications are anticipated to grow as technology progresses, providing fresh approaches to various industries.
